What Are Safety Compliance Certifications?
At its core, a safety compliance certification is a formal, third-party confirmation that a company's products, processes, or facility meet specific, predefined standards. These standards are often developed by industry bodies, international organizations, or regulatory agencies. The certification process typically involves a comprehensive audit to evaluate a company's adherence to these standards, ensuring that quality control and safety protocols are consistently implemented and documented.
In the context of dietary supplements, certifications often focus on key areas like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P), which cover everything from ingredient sourcing and facility sanitation to equipment maintenance and record-keeping. Other certifications might address specific concerns such as ingredient purity, absence of contaminants, or environmental sustainability. The primary purpose is to provide a reliable, verifiable assurance of quality that stakeholders can trust.
Why Are These Certifications Important?
The importance of safety certifications extends across multiple levels of a business and the wider industry. For a company, these certifications serve as a critical tool for risk management, helping to standardize operations and minimize the potential for errors or contamination. They also serve as a powerful symbol of credibility, distinguishing a brand in a market where consumers are increasingly conscious of product quality and safety.
Beyond brand reputation, certifications can open doors to new business opportunities. Many large retailers and distributors require their suppliers to hold specific certifications as a condition of partnership. This makes certification not just a mark of excellence, but often a practical necessity for scaling a business. On a larger scale, widespread adherence to certifications contributes to a more transparent and reliable supplement industry, fostering greater consumer confidence across the market.
Key Principles of a Compliance Program
Developing a robust safety compliance program is not a one-time event but an ongoing commitment. Several core principles form the foundation of any effective program. These principles help create a systematic approach to managing quality and safety throughout the entire product lifecycle.
A successful program typically incorporates the following elements:
- Risk Assessment: Proactively identifying potential hazards in your processes, from raw material sourcing to production and distribution, is the first step. This involves evaluating the likelihood and severity of each risk to determine where controls are most needed.
- Documented Procedures: Creating clear, detailed standard operating procedures (SOPs) ensures that every step of your process is performed consistently and can be reviewed by auditors. This documentation provides the evidence needed to demonstrate compliance.
- Verification and Auditing: Regular internal audits help you verify that your procedures are being followed correctly. These audits, along with external audits from certifying bodies, are essential for identifying areas for improvement and maintaining your certification status.
- Traceability: Implementing a robust traceability system allows you to track ingredients and finished products from their origin to the final consumer. This is critical for efficiently managing potential recalls and investigating any quality issues that arise.
- Continuous Improvement: A compliance program is not static. It requires a commitment to regularly reviewing your systems, incorporating lessons learned from audits and customer feedback, and adapting to new regulations or scientific developments.
The Certification Process: A General Overview
While the specific steps can vary between certification schemes, the general process typically follows a similar path. It usually begins with an application to a recognized certification body. This is followed by a period of preparation where the company conducts a gap analysis to identify any areas that do not yet meet the required standard and implements necessary changes.
The next step is a comprehensive audit conducted by the certification body. This audit may be a document review, an on-site inspection, or a combination of both. If the auditor finds that the company meets all requirements, the certification is granted. Maintaining the certification then requires regular surveillance audits and a commitment to addressing any non-conformities found during these visits. This cycle ensures that standards are consistently upheld, not just met on the day of the initial audit.
The Role of Audits and Inspections
Audits are the cornerstone of the certification system. They provide an independent and objective evaluation of a company's compliance with a given standard. A well-conducted audit goes beyond simply checking paperwork; it involves observing operations, interviewing personnel, and reviewing records to ensure that what is documented is actually happening in practice. This inspection process helps to identify not only obvious problems but also potential weaknesses in the quality management system that could lead to future issues.
Understanding the audit process is vital for any business seeking certification. It requires a culture of transparency and a willingness to be scrutinized. Viewing the audit not as a punitive measure but as an opportunity to improve your systems is the key to a successful outcome. The insights gained from audits can lead to more efficient operations and a stronger overall approach to quality.
From Strategy to Implementation
Moving from a strategic understanding of compliance to practical implementation is the most significant step for many businesses. It requires translating the requirements of a standard into actionable procedures within your daily operations. This process often begins with assembling a dedicated team or appointing a compliance officer responsible for overseeing the initiative.
Implementation also involves educating and training your entire staff. Everyone, from those on the production line to those in management, needs to understand their role in maintaining compliance. This collaborative effort ensures that quality is not seen as a separate department's function but as an integral part of the company culture. Successful implementation ultimately makes compliance a seamless part of how you do business, supporting your reputation and resilience.
